New in PN: How Trump's lawyers are trying to make him a king

"In practical terms, if Trump gets SCOTUS to agree he has unfettered power to remove members of independent regulatory agencies, their independence is over. No more will they issue decisions that don’t reflect his policy preferences."
How Trump's lawyers are trying to make him a king
They're advancing a roided-up version of the "unitary executive theory."

One of most important legal developments happened in Judge Colleen Kollar-Kotelly's courtroom on Monday.

As I have noted, KEY issue to watch is claim that Musk/DOGE are operating in violation of Appointments Clause. It's the whole ballgame.

Judge Kollar-Kotelly appears aligned with Judge Chutkan:
Judge Questions Constitutionality of Musk’s DOGE Operation
The judge expressed concern over the unresolved issues about who is in charge of Elon Musk’s so-called Department of Government Efficiency, if it is not Mr. Musk, as the White House has claimed.
